Comedian Greg Giraldo Dead at Age 44




Posted by Veronica Santiago Categories: Television, Obituaries,

Greg Giraldo

UPDATE: TMZ reports that Giraldo’s family had pulled him off life support.

Comedian Greg Giraldo, best known to television audiences for his work on Last Comic Standing and the Comedy Central roasts, died today in New Jersey. He was 44 years old.

Giraldo’s passing comes less than a week after he was hospitalized for an accidental overdose. According to friends of the funnyman, he had been taking prescription pills. His death is not being considered a suicide.

After word of Greg’s death circulated, many celebrities turned to Twitter to express their condolences. “Greg Giraldo was a great and funny man,” Jimmy Kimmel wrote. “RIP Greg Giraldo. Belly-laugh hilarious, prolific, good & kind.  A thousand oys can’t express,” Sarah Silverman tweeted.

“There are no words 2 express what a shame it is 2 lose Greg Giraldo,” Lisa Lampanelli, another fixture on the roasts, expressed. “His smart humor was unparalleled & he will be missed for yrs to come.”

A date for Giraldo’s memorial has not yet been announced.
